141A. The County Commissioners of Cecil County are here-
by directed to levy, on the assessable property in Cecil County,
annually, the sum of Five Thousand Six Hundred Dollars
($5, 600. 00), for the purpose of assisting in the maintenance of
the seven volunteer fire companies in Cecil County, namely,
Cecilton Fire Company, Chesapeake City Fire Company, Sing-
erly Fire Company of Elkton, North East Fire Company, Com-
munity Fire Company of Perryville, Water Witch Fire Com-
pany at Port Deposit and the Rising Sun Fire Company. The
first levy shall be made in the month of June, 1937, and the
said sum of money to be paid by the County Commissioners of
Cecil County to the said seven volunteer fire companies pro-
rata, and the said County Commissioners are hereby directed
to require each of the said seven volunteer fire companies to
file, annually, a fair statement of the value of their respective
fire fighting apparatus, which said statement shall include
the character of the same, date of purchase and estimated
depreciation. Each of the said seven volunteer fire com-
panies shall also file with the County Commissioners a detailed
and itemized statement of all of the fires to which their re-
spective companies have rendered service during the previous
year, the estimated value of the property in which any fire
shall occur during the year and estimated loss to the same by
reason of any fire.

141B. The County Commissioners shall pay out of the taxes
collected in Cecil County, in each and every year, to each of
the said seven volunteer fire companies the sum of Eight
Hundred Dollars (§800. 00), at stated periods during the cur-
rent year and each of the said seven volunteer companies are
hereby required to file at the end of the current year with the
County Commissioners a full and fair statement of how the
said sums of money so paid to each of them shall have been
expended, provided', however, that the said County Commis-
sioners shall make no payment to any fire company organized
after June 1, 1937, unless such company shall apply to said
County Commissioners and receive the approval of said Com-
missioners for its organization.

SEC. 2. And T)e it farther enacted, That this Act shall take
effect June 1, 1937.

Approved May 18, 1937.
